Read the following text and answer the following question on the basis of the same : Growth of population with time shows specific and predictable patters. Two types of growth patter of populaiton are exponetial and logistic growth . When resource in the habitat are unlimited each species has the ability to relize fully its innate potential to grow in number . Then the population gorws in exponential fashion . When the resource are limited growth curve shows an inital slow rate and then it accelerates and finally slows giving the gorwth curve which is sigmoid .
